Removing pet stains from jute rugs can be tricky since jute is highly absorbent, and excessive water can damage its fibers. This comprehensive guide by mask associates, the jute experts, details how to clean a jute rug. Dip a cloth in the vinegar solution. When your pet has an accident on your jute rug, it’s important to clean it up promptly to prevent stains and odors. After blotting away the urine with paper towels, use a 50/50 mixture of white vinegar and water to treat the stain. Then, shake the dry carpet.
